Europe’s Deadly Heatwave Escalates: Red Alerts, Record-Temp Fears—What’s Next for Markets?
A deadly heatwave is sweeping across Europe, prompting the highest-level red heat warnings in Britain and France and record-temperature preparations in the UK. Reporting on June 24 highlights that Britain is bracing for temperatures that could break records, while France and Italy have issued severe alerts, including Italy’s red warning for 16 cities. The coverage frames the event as a major public-safety and infrastructure stress test, with heat-related disruptions already being discussed alongside emergency readiness. Separate reporting also points to the broader climate context, arguing the extreme conditions are being amplified by long-term warming rather than El Niño. Geopolitically, the episode matters because extreme heat is increasingly acting like a “slow-moving shock” that strains governments, health systems, and labor productivity across multiple states at once. The immediate power dynamic is between national emergency services and the scale of demand placed on electricity grids, transport networks, and public services during peak summer hours. While no single actor is responsible, the policy response becomes a competitive arena: governments must decide how aggressively to impose heat rules, adjust work schedules, and protect vulnerable populations without triggering economic backlash. The fact that warnings are simultaneously escalating across the UK, France, and Italy raises the risk of cross-border spillovers in supply chains, logistics, and insurance pricing, even without any deliberate political confrontation. Market and economic implications are likely to concentrate in power generation and grid operations, transport and logistics, and insurance. Heatwaves typically lift demand for electricity (cooling) while reducing output from thermal plants due to cooling-water constraints, increasing the probability of higher wholesale power prices and grid balancing costs; in Europe, this can quickly ripple into industrial electricity-intensive sectors. Investors may also watch for impacts on agriculture and food supply chains, where drought and heat can pressure yields and raise risk premia for soft commodities, though the articles here focus more on warnings than crop specifics. In the near term, the most visible “price signal” would be volatility in European power benchmarks and potential widening in risk spreads for insurers and utilities exposed to weather-related claims. What to watch next is whether red alerts expand to additional regions, whether authorities move from advisory measures to enforceable restrictions (workplace heat rules, school/transport adjustments), and how quickly grid operators report stress. Key indicators include electricity load peaks, cooling-water temperature limits, and any emergency procurement or demand-response actions by system operators. Another trigger is the emergence of secondary incidents—heat-related hospital surges, transport disruptions, or localized water shortages—that can convert a weather event into a broader economic shock. Over the next several days, escalation or de-escalation will hinge on forecasted temperature trajectories and overnight cooling, while policymakers will be judged on whether protective measures reduce casualties without causing avoidable productivity losses.
